前提・実現したいこと
Nuxtで'created()'でDataを定義して、表示したいと考えてます。
'console.log(item)'でJSONが帰ってくてるので、値がうまく渡させてないと思います。
該当のソースコード
vue
1<template> 2 <div class="wrapper"> 3 <p>{{ items }}</p> 4 </div> 5</template> 6 7<script> 8 data() { 9 return { 10 items: [], 11 } 12 }, 13 async created() { 14 const snap = await this.ref_req.add(query); 15 const key = await snap.id; 16 let item 17 await this.ref_res.doc(key).onSnapshot(async function(snap) { 18 if (snap.data() == undefined ){ 19 return; 20 }else{ 21 item = await snap.data() 22 await snap.ref.delete() 23 console.log(item) 24 return {items : item } 25 } 26 }) 27 } 28} 29 30</script>
上記のコードに何か間違いはありそうでしょうか?
よろしくお願いいたします
回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。